Havana Glasgow Film Festival Wee Spanish Mobile Library – Havanita Family Screening Wed 16 November, 2016


Wed 16 November 2016
CCA
11am, Free (unticketed), Cinema
All ages
0141 352 4900
Havana Glasgow Film Festival
Tue 15 November — Sat 19 November 2016
Come and join The Wee Spanish Mobile Library and visual artist and puppeteer, Sonia Gardés, for a Havanita morning of Cuban cartoons, stories and songs in Spanish. Suitable for children aged 3-7years + family
